Ravenswood, Long Island City, NY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ravenswood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ravenswood Studio Apartments | $3,870 | $2,840 | $6,000 |
| Ravenswood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,753 | $2,500 | $9,594 |
Ravenswood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$6,702 | $3,150 | $10,000+ |
| Ravenswood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,069 | $3,450 | $10,000+ |
| Ravenswood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,300 | $4,300 | $4,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Ravenswood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Ravenswood with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Ravenswood is at The Doria listed at $4,900.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Ravenswood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Ravenswood is $6,702.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Ravenswood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Ravenswood is a 1,153 square feet unit starting from $5,495 at Alta+.
What is the average size for Ravenswood 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Ravenswood is currently 858 sq ft.
